X
Start Chat
Close

This business is currently offline. Please try again later.

Close

dr g t hart pathfields practice in Sandhaven, Fraserburgh, Aberdeenshire

  1. Dr E Barr - Moray Coast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 337 1190
    0345 337 1190
    Moray Coast Medical Practice Lossiemouth IV316TU
  2. Dr R Batra - Moray Coast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 337 1190
    0345 337 1190
    Moray Coast Medical Practice Lossiemouth IV316TU
  3. Dr B Chirangi -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
  4. Dr A Glennie - Torphins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    01339 882221
    01339 882221
    Torphins Medical Practice Torphins Banchory AB314JQ
  5. Dr G Rutledge -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
  6. Dr J Owen -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
  7. West End Dental Practice Within Dr Grays Hospital

    Local Dentists in Sandhaven, Fraserburgh, Aberdeenshire
    01343 567891
    01343 567891
    West Road Elgin IV301SN
  8. Dr J Penney - Maryhill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 337 0610
    0345 337 0610
    Maryhill Group Practice Incl Rothes Elgin IV301AT
  9. Dr K McArthur - Moray Coast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 337 1190
    0345 337 1190
    Moray Coast Medical Practice Lossiemouth IV316TU
  10. Dr N Ferguson - Moray Coast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 337 1190
    0345 337 1190
    Moray Coast Medical Practice Lossiemouth IV316TU
  11. Dr B Ledingham - Moray Coast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 337 1190
    0345 337 1190
    Moray Coast Medical Practice Lossiemouth IV316TU
  12. Dr S Macfadyen - Moray Coast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 337 1190
    0345 337 1190
    Moray Coast Medical Practice Lossiemouth IV316TU
  13. Dr R Mercer - Torphins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    01339 882221
    01339 882221
    Torphins Medical Practice Torphins Banchory AB314JQ
  14. Dr C Walker -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
  15. Dr C Jack - Moray Coast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 337 1190
    0345 337 1190
    Moray Coast Medical Practice Lossiemouth IV316TU
  16. Dr J Henderson -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
  17. Dr V Thomson - Maryhill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 337 0610
    0345 337 0610
    Maryhill Group Practice Incl Rothes Elgin IV301AT
  18. Dr G Archbold -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
  19. Dr M Hashmi -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
  20. Dr W Mouat - Torphins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    01339 882221
    01339 882221
    Torphins Medical Practice Torphins Banchory AB314JQ
  21. Dr E Ballantyne -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
  22. Dr L Ballantyne (Wade) - Torphins Medical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    01339 882221
    01339 882221
    Torphins Medical Practice Torphins Banchory AB314JQ
  23. Dr V Steven -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
  24. Dr S Baldwin -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
  25. Dr N Showell - Banchory Group Practice

    Local Doctors in Sandhaven, Fraserburgh, Aberdeenshire
    0345 013 0750
    0345 013 0750
    Banchory Group Practice Banchory AB315XS
51 - 75 of 514
X

Loading more results...

Privacy Policy